S.EE Docs
Entwickler

Erste Schritte

S.EE REST API zum Erstellen, Verwalten und Nachverfolgen von Kurz-URLs, Textfreigaben und Dateifreigaben

Überblick

Mit der S.EE API können Sie Kurzlinks, Textfreigaben und Dateifreigaben programmgesteuert erstellen und verwalten. Sie können sie verwenden, um:

  • Kurzlinks in großem Maßstab zu erstellen
  • Text-Snippets und Code mit Syntaxhervorhebung zu teilen
  • Dateien hochzuladen und zu teilen
  • Benutzerdefinierte Domains zu verwalten
  • Analysedaten abzurufen
  • S.EE in Ihre Anwendungen zu integrieren

Erste Schritte

Voraussetzungen

  1. Ein S.EE-Konto mit aktivem Tarif
  2. Ein API-Zugriffstoken

Authentifizierung

Alle API-Anfragen erfordern ein Zugriffstoken im Header Authorization:

Authorization: Bearer YOUR_ACCESS_TOKEN

Basis-URL

https://s.ee/api/v1

Beispielanfragen

Kurz-URL erstellen

curl -X POST "https://s.ee/api/v1/shorten" \
  -H "Authorization: Bearer YOUR_ACCESS_TOKEN" \
  -H "Content-Type: application/json" \
  -d '{
    "target_url": "https://example.com/very-long-url",
    "domain": "s.ee",
    "custom_slug": "my-link"
  }'

Textfreigabe erstellen

curl -X POST "https://s.ee/api/v1/text" \
  -H "Authorization: Bearer YOUR_ACCESS_TOKEN" \
  -H "Content-Type: application/json" \
  -d '{
    "title": "My Code Snippet",
    "content": "console.log(\"Hello, World!\");",
    "text_type": "source_code",
    "domain": "fs.to"
  }'

Datei hochladen

curl -X POST "https://s.ee/api/v1/file/upload" \
  -H "Authorization: Bearer YOUR_ACCESS_TOKEN" \
  -F "file=@/path/to/your/file.png" \
  -F "domain=fs.to"

Ressourcen

Auf dieser Seite